School Exclusions

During 2007/08 there were 39,717 exclusions from local authority schools in Scotland, a decrease of 11% from 2006/07. In 164 cases, pupils were removed from the register of the school, though local authorities may also reach agreements with parents to move a pupil to another school without the use of a formal 'removal from register'

Rates were highest in S3. Pupils who are excluded are more likely to live in areas of higher deprivation, have additional support needs or be looked after by the local authority.
